3 Potential Trade Partners For Miami Dolphins CB Jalen Ramsey
There were many trade rumors floating around the 2025 NFL Draft last week.
The Miami Dolphins were right in the middle as cornerback Jalen Ramsey seemingly became available. There was no deal made but there could be many teams looking for an experienced corner that is still playing at an extremely-high level.
Below, check out three teams that have the assets and need to get this deal done.
3. Baltimore Ravens
The Baltimore Ravens have seen plenty of injuries in the secondary in recent years. This led to moves being made over the last two years, including Nate Wiggins in the draft last year. The Ravens signed Chidobe Awuzie in free agency prior to the draft as well. There is one final move that could solidify the secondary for a Super Bowl contender like Baltimore. The Ravens will enter the season as one of the top teams in the league once again. Ramsey would give them a true No. 1 cornerback and add even more depth to a unit that could use it.
2. Arizona Cardinals
Jonathan Gannon has worked hard this offseason to build up his defense in Arizona. The plan was put into motion in free agency with big-time additions such as Josh Sweat, Calais Campbell, and Dalvin Tomlinson. The Cardinals continued to beef up the defensive line with Walter Nolen in the draft. The team still has over $30 million in cap space this season. If the Cardinals want to make a move in a strong NFC, the addition of Ramsey could go a long way. There are many top-end wide receivers that Arizona will have to go through. The duo of Ramsey and Sean Murphy-Bunting would immediately become one of the top in the league.
1. Las Vegas Raiders
Don’t look now but the Las Vegas Raiders are stacking up assets. Pete Carroll was brought in to get the franchise back to neutral. His early moves included trading for and extending Geno Smith to give the team a quarterback. Las Vegas needed a running back and saw Ashton Jeanty fall into its lap during the draft. The Raiders could use some help in the secondary and Ramsey would provide help right away. It would give the Raiders a chance to shut teams down at all three levels.
